Focus: Listening and Speaking

Learning Standard(s): 1.1.1 (g), 1.2.2 (a), 1.1.4 {SK & SJK}

Objective(s): By the end of the lesson, pupils will be able to:i. blend and segment orally.

Time: 30/60 minutes

Teaching Aid(s): letter cards, word cards, chart, phoneme card

Cross Curricular Element(s): Multiple Intelligence, Creativity and Innovation

Introduction:

a. Greet pupils. b. Pupils reply.

Set Induction:

a. Demonstrate the actions.b. Ask pupils to guess the sound.c. Do the action and say the sound.

Step 1:

a Display a series of pictures on the board. (Appendix 1)

b. Get pupils to name the pictures.c. Talk about the picture stressing on the focus words.

Step 2:

a. Revise the sounds and their actions. Use the focus words.b. Do the actions together and get pupils to say the sounds.c. Get pupils to say the words and the sounds.d. Repeat the activity in groups.

Focus words:cat, kid, sit, nap, mat, cot, pin, cap, tip, dig,

pit ,dog

265

Step 3:

a. Identify three pupils and give them a letter card each. (Appendix 2)

b. Say /k/ twice and turn the pupil holding the letter ‘c’ to face the class.

c. Repeat the action with the letter ‘a’.d. Blend the two sounds and say it twice.e. Then go to the third pupil and say /t/ twice. f. Blend the three sounds. g. Repeat all the actions and ask pupils to follow.h. Do the same with the other words.

Step 4:

a. Write a word on the board. Example: tapb. Get pupils to say the word. c. Get pupils to identify the different sounds in the word.d. Distribute letter cards.e. Get pupils to show the letter card for the first sound.f. Pupils say the sound /t/.g. Next, guide pupils to show the letter card for the second sound.h. Pupils say /æ/.i. Pupils show the letter card for the third sound.j. Pupils say /p/.k. Say ‘tap’ has three sounds: /t/, /æ/, /p/.

Consolidation:

a. Divide pupils into pairs.b. Distribute picture cards, word cards and letter cards.c. A pupil picks a picture card and names it.d. The other pupil will blend the sounds into words. Example:

Say /k/, /æ/, /p/ (repeat thrice) then say the word ‘cap’.

Focus: Reading

Learning Standard(s): 2.1.2 (a) – (c),2.1.3,2.1.4,2.2.1 (a) & (b){SK & SJK}

Objective(s): By the end of the lesson, pupils will be able to:i. blend phonemes into words;ii. segment words to spell; andiii. follow simple instructions.

Time: 30/60 minutes

Teaching Aid(s): picture cards, text chart , letter cards, bingo cards, rebus chart

Cross Curricular Element(s): Multiple Intelligence, Creativity and Innovation

Introduction:

a. Greet pupils. b. Pupils reply.

Set Induction:

a. Show the pictures. (Appendix 3)b. Get pupils to name the pictures.c. Get pupils to blend the phonemes to form words.

Step 1:

a. Display the pictures. (Appendix 3)b. Read the text. (Appendix 4)c. Read the text again.d. Get pupils to read the focus words.

Step 2:

a. Display the text on the board. (Appendix 5)b. Read the text. Replace the pictures with words.c. Read the text again.d. Get pupils to say the words to replace the picture.e. Distribute letter cards. (Appendix 2)f. Point to a picture in the text. (Appendix 5)g. Get pupils to blend the phonemes to form the word.
